Where the ETHOS E6 LRF truly separates itself is with the integration of our DeadEye Laser™ and Auto Ballistics system.
The DeadEye Laser™ is built for one purpose: absolute certainty. By separating the emitter and receiver into two non-overlapping channels, it eliminates the interference common in traditional all-in-one laser modules. The result is faster, more reliable ranging with improved consistency shot after shot. Integrated directly into the objective housing and aligned with the optical center, DeadEye delivers clean signal return, reduced angular error, and rapid target acquisition in real-world conditions.
Once a range is acquired, the Auto Ballistics system calculates your shot solution and presehttps://waveinfrared.com/wp-admin/edit.php?post_type=productnts a secondary reticle for precise shot placement at the ranged distance—removing guesswork and ensuring success.

X-WAVE™ Lens | High-Energy Infrared Transmission
Thermal performance lives or dies by one thing—how much infrared energy reaches the sensor. If the lens is undersized, lacks material purity, is poorly machined, or fails to perform across the full spectral band, performance is compromised from the start.
Simply put: if the lens falls short, everything else follows.
With its large 44mm diameter, the X-WAVE™ Lens captures and transmits significantly more usable energy—up to 58% more than typical 35mm systems.
That increase translates directly into cleaner images, stronger contrast, and improved detection range in real-world conditions—especially in high humidity.
This isn’t a marginal upgrade. It’s a fundamental advantage built into the core of the system.

GloveGrip™ Focus
Locking onto your target quickly and effortlessly is critical—and that’s exactly what our ambidextrous GloveGrip™ Focus system delivers.
A tall, tactile focus knob sits on top of the front lens assembly, making it easy to find and adjust, even in complete darkness.
Unlike traditional “dog collar” focus designs, it requires only a slight two-finger movement, eliminating the need for large shoulder, arm, wrist, or hand motions.
The result is faster adjustments while keeping your eye in the scope and your aim on target.
With its smooth, perfectly tuned resistance, the knob lets you dial in precise focus every time—fast and easy.

Relentless Runtime™
When the moment demands it, the last thing you should worry about is battery life.
Our oversized, high-capacity power system—Relentless Runtime™—is engineered to keep you in the field far longer than conventional setups, even in frigid weather.
Designed for extended operation, it delivers significantly more runtime between charges than competing systems.
Because it uses a non-proprietary, commercially available 26650 battery, finding a spare is easy and affordable—no special orders or high replacement costs.
Whether you’re tracking, scanning, or waiting for the perfect shot, Relentless Runtime™ ensures your scope is always ready—because cutting your hunt short isn’t an option.
Special note: The Relentless Runtime™ battery compartment also accommodates the popular 18650 battery when used with the included spacer.

ETHOS E6 LRF Specs
Thermal Sensor: 640 x 512
Sensor Pixel Size / Frame Rate: 12 Micron / 50 Hz
Objective Lens Diameter: 44 mm
NETD: <18mK
Field-of-View: 670′ at 1000 Yards (2.5x Optical Mag.)
Base Level Magnification: 2.5x (Before Any Digital Zoom)
Digital Magnification: 2.5x to 10x with 2 Options (Rapid and Smooth)
Display Type/Resolution: ViewMax Display™ 1600 x 1200 w/ Widefield Technology
Display Brightness Adjustment: Yes
Color Palette Modes: 6 (White, Black, Red, Green, Golden, Violet)
Picture-in-Picture (PIP): Yes
Recoil Activated Recording: Yes with Sensitivity Threshold Adjustment
Hot Tracking: Yes
Outline Mode: Yes
Reticle Design Options: 9 (Plus a “No Reticle” 10th Option)
Reticle Color Options: Black or White with Polarity Reversal Option
Reticle Illuminated Dot: Yes, 4 Designs w/ Center Dot Illumination
Reticle Center Dot: 3 Illumination Options (Red, Blue, Green)
Reticle Focal Plane Options: Yes (Front Focal or Second Focal)
Multiple Gun Profiles: Yes (Save up to 5 Different Zeros)
Gun Profile Nicknaming: Yes (Caliber Labeling and Zero Distance)
Detection Range: Up to 2900 Yards
Start-Up Time: 5 Seconds
Auto Shutdown: Yes with 4 Options (Off, 30, 60, and 90 Minutes)
Media Recording Yes: (Photo, Video, and Audio with On or Off)
Media File Management: Yes (On-Board Viewing and File Deletion)
WIFI: Yes
Battery Type: (1x) 26650 Protected – (Optionally Sleeved 18650)
Expected Battery Life: 10 Hours
Recoil Rating: 6,000 J
Nitrogen Purged: Yes
Scope Length: 13″
Scope Tube Size: 30mm (25 Inch Pound Ring Attachment)
Weight: 36 oz. (Without Battery)
Waterproof Rating: IP67
Laser Class: Class 1
Laser Ranging Distance: 1300 Yards
